1. HEALTH HAZARDS

Clogged sewers can create significant health hazards. Sewage backups can cause foul odours, which can lead to respiratory problems, headaches, and nausea. Sewage backups can also contaminate the environment, including local water sources, which can have long-term effects on human health and wildlife. Sewage contains harmful bacteria, viruses, and parasites that can cause illnesses, including diarrhea, vomiting, and infections.

2. PROPERTY DAMAGE

Clogged sewers can cause severe property damage. Sewage backups can cause water damage, which can lead to mould growth, structural damage, and electrical problems. Sewage backups can also damage personal belongings, including furniture, electronics, and clothing. Cleaning up after a sewage backup can be expensive and time-consuming, and it may require the services of a professional restoration company.

3. ENVIRONMENTAL CONTAMINATION

Clogged sewers can contaminate the environment, including local water sources. When sewage backups occur, the sewage can seep into the ground, contaminating the soil and groundwater. This can have long-term effects on human health and wildlife. Sewage contains harmful bacteria, viruses, and parasites that can harm plants, animals, and aquatic life.

4. INSECT AND RODENT INFESTATIONS

Clogged sewers can create ideal conditions for insect and rodent infestations. Sewage backups can attract flies, mosquitoes, and other insects, which can carry diseases and spread bacteria. Sewage backups can also attract rodents, including rats and mice, which can carry diseases and cause property damage. SEWER REPAIRS

Repairs to sewer systems are a essential aspect of ensuring a reliable sanitation system. Sewers are responsible for transporting wastewater, including human waste, from residential properties and commercial sites to processing stations. If failures occur within the sewer system, it can result in serious health risks and environmental hazards.Sewer repairs require fixing any damage to the pipes or supporting framework that might cause blockages. Sewer pipes can be weakened for a variety of reasons, including ageing infrastructure, tree root intrusion, soil movement, and heavy usage. Typical signs of sewer trouble include gurgling sinks, sewage overflow, unpleasant odours, and sewage emerging at surface level

HOW ARE SEWER REPAIRS PERFORMED?

Sewer repairs are generally initiated by a camera inspection, which involves feeding a small camera through the pipes to locate the location and cause of the damage. Once the fault has been identified, the sewer repair technician will select the most effective strategy. Sewer repairs can be carried out using multiple approaches, depending on the type of the damage.One of the most widely used sewer repair techniques is to cut out and renew the faulty pipework. This method involves opening up the ground to get to the damaged pipe, removing the affected portion, and replacing it with a modern pipe. While this method is effective, it can be costly, as it requires disturbing surfaces to access the sewer infrastructure.Another technique is no-dig repair, which involves restoring the damaged pipe without digging. This is done by gaining entry via small access points and using advanced equipment to feed a flexible sleeve inside the existing pipe. This method is typically speedier and minimally invasive than traditional repair techniques, though it may not be suitable for certain types of pipe damage.
